Folios 197-199. A letter from Dun [Duncan] Campbell, enclosing one from the Lord Mayor of London, James Esdaile. Folio 198. Advises that overcrowding at Newgate [prison, London] is so great that the keeper, Mr [Richard] Akerman [Ackerman], says there is no room to hold prisoners arriving for trial at the Old Bailey.
